I’ve steered clear of advice on how to promote an existing blog in this post, but it’s worth just touching on how important outreach is from day one. Commenting on others’ blogs, offering to guest post (or inviting guest posts on your own blog), participating in forums, responding to any feedback or comments you receive…. all of this is hugely important in establishing your name and brand online and should be included in the first (and all following) stages of your blog launch.
